Mountains in Africa, on the way home.

I grew up on a Karoo sheep farm about 40 miles down this dirt road, at the western end of the Nuweveld mountain range. My parents retired and sold the farm in the mid '90s and I've only driven this road once since then. Mom and I always thought that, from this point, the mountains looked like a pride of lions lying down. Dad and my sister never quite got it! My family indulged my need for a short detour to take this picture when we were driving up the national road at the start of our holiday. You can see that the picture has been taken in winter because the sky is a thin, pale blue.

All that's changed since my childhood is the green water tank at the house on the left; and the game fence on the right. South African National Parks (SANParks) have been buying up large tracts of the Karoo to create a mega national park. All the farms on the right-hand side of the road up to the mountains have been purchased by SANParks to be added to the Karoo Park in time.
